South Africa - Solar Energy Generation
Since 2014, South Africa Solar Energy Generation jumped by 36.2% year on year. With 5.26 Terawatthours in 2019, the country was ranked number 16 among other countries in Solar Energy Generation. South Africa is overtaken by Brazil, which was number 15 with 5.56 Terawatthours and is followed by Netherlands with 5.19 Terawatthours. China lead the ranking with 223.8 Terawatthours in 2019, an increase of 26.5% versus 2018. United States, Japan and Germany resp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Turkey recorded the best 5 years average growth at +264.4% per year, while Slovakia recorded the worst performance at -0.3% per year.
